Overview

The Compacity of Spacetime} introduces a bold new theory: in that the structure of the universe arises not from force or mass, but from the intrinsic compression of spacetime itself. In Spacetime Compacity Theory (SCT), gravity, redshift, and quantum behavior emerge from organized vortices and structural gradients - not from curvature or particle exchange. Objects move along paths of steepest compacity, where both time and distance are minimized. This theory offers a unified explanation for cosmic structure, galaxy rotation, and quantum effects - without invoking dark matter or speculative forces. It's not just a new model - it's a new way to see the fabric of reality, a new paradigm.
